In this episode of The Girl Mom Life with Casey Gray, I’m sharing the honest reason I stepped away from the podcast for the month of February. After talking with other women in my community and reflecting on my own experience with seasonal depression, I realized that February can be one of the hardest months emotionally. The combination of limited sunlight, winter fatigue, grief triggers, and life transitions can create a heaviness that many of us quietly carry. In this episode, I open up about what this “funky February” felt like for me and why I chose to pause, rest, and honor the season I was in instead of forcing creativity or productivity. I also walk you through the simple practices that helped me move through the month with more grace—things like supporting my gut health, allowing myself more rest, getting outside in the sunlight, removing unhealthy escapes, journaling honestly, and leaning into faith and community. Most importantly, I share what this season reminded me of: it’s okay to feel sadness, it’s okay to slow down, and no season lasts forever. If you’ve been feeling a little heavy, tired, or emotionally stretched this winter, I hope my story reminds you that you’re not alone—and that brighter days are ahead, mama.
